Your California Privacy Rights
Under the CCPA, California consumers hold these rights regarding personal information maintained by finhubconnect.com: the right to know what categories, sources, and purposes guide our collection; the right to view specific information we hold; the right to have information corrected; the right to request deletion; the right to decline sale and sharing; the right to restrict use of sensitive personal information; and the right to remain free from adverse treatment for asserting these rights.
How to Exercise Your Rights
To submit a CCPA request to finhubconnect.com, use our Contact form or reach us at the email provided on the Contact page. We verify requests using reasonable procedures—typically confirming your access to a registered email or matching the details you supply against our existing records—to guard against fraud. Once verified, we provide a response within the 45-day statutory period, utilizing one additional 45-day extension if circumstances warrant.
An authorized agent (including privacy advocates, legal representatives, or similar fiduciaries) may file a CCPA request for you. finhubconnect.com will ask for proof of your written authorization or a valid power of attorney and may contact you directly to validate the request and your identity. We will reject any submission that does not satisfy the CCPA's proof and verification standards.
